Ondo First Lady and Son Defy Ailing Governor Akeredolu’s Request for Hometown Move. – Reports

Balogun DamilolaBy Balogun DamilolaNo CommentsDecember 11, 2023Updated:December 11, 20232 Mins Read
Share
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

The first lady of Ondo State, Betty Anyanwu-Akeredolu and her son, Babajide have kept Governor Rotimi Akeredolu in Ibadan, the Oyo State capital, against his wishes, According to a report by Sahara Reporters. 

Earlier on Monday reported that the ailing governor had been receiving chemotherapy for the treatment of leukaemia (blood cancer).

The governor is said to be barely conscious during the day or at night and that the medication knocks him out for ten hours every time.

Sahara Reports that that during a period when the governor was sufficiently conscious, he requested to be taken to Owo, his hometown in Ondo State by his family, expressing his preference to pass away there. But however reportedly, his family—Betty and Babajide in particular—ignored the governor’s request because they were afraid it would expose his actual health status.

When the governor was lucid enough, he requested that his family return him to his Owo home and said he’d prefer to die there but his family, led by his son and wife refused to transfer him fearing his real condition would be leaked by untrustworthy family members and aides.

“The governor was recently in Lagos where he received some treatment before being taken to Ibadan in Oyo State,” one of the family sources said.
